Serenity Fae Salvacion discovers her true identity, as she navigates her new reality she finds herself falling in love with her bestfriend, Gia Catamores. Together, they explore the complexities of their feelings and the world around them, struggling to reconcile their desires with the expectations of society. A powerful and poignant story of two women who find themselves at each other in the midst of a world that can be both beautiful and cruel. Published: 3/1/23
